Output 89cb718faad3a5b96da93fe5b7d12520e8ec06f2cf80afdd69a2bb1ad1d4d28d:4

value
35261086
script pubkey
OP_0 OP_PUSHBYTES_20 5966c41f6ee0372f8f98388bbada7055db145944
address
bc1qt9nvg8mwuqmjlruc8z9m4kns2hd3gk2ylsdryp
transaction
89cb718faad3a5b96da93fe5b7d12520e8ec06f2cf80afdd69a2bb1ad1d4d28d
confirmations
42306
spent
true